WCS Premier Preview (R16 Groups C and D)


I'm on the clock as I hadn't realised half of each of the four groups was happening today with them wrapping up tomorrow.  With that said, here are the predictions for the other two groups in the R16.  If you spot any errors or omissions please let me know.

Group C
The only group with two Koreans features all three races.  Oddly MaNa is the player entering the fray with a clean record (cleaning up an ill viOLet and Bunny); Polt didn't lose a series, but lost games to both Jim and Kelazhur; Hydra lost to MorroW before beating him in the re-match (along with knocking off iAsonu), while Swarmhoster FireCake arrives on the back of beating puCK twice.

Polt vs FireCake - the odds are less overwhelming (66%) than they should be, as Polt is 25-1 against foreigners for the past year or so in BO3s (losing only to Kane back in January); FireCake's last win against a notable Korean Terran was beating MMA a year ago, so conclusion is obvious here
Hydra vs MaNa - the Korean is an overwhelming favourite (71%), so is there hope for MaNa?  Given Hydra's 21-0 record vs foreign Protoss' I don't think so
Losers Match
MaNa vs FireCake - despite this being the Frenchman's best match-up, MaNa is the favourite (61%); FireCake beat MaNa just a month ago at the Fragbite Masters and the Polish players PvZ of late isn't that impressive, but given how predictable the Frenchman is I'll go with MaNa regardless
Winners Match
Polt vs Hydra - the Zerg is just as much a favourite (71%) as he was against the Polish player above and Polt has been awful against Korean Zergs (2-8 in his last ten BO3s); Hydra's record in the match-up isn't perfect, but includes beating Polt a couple of months ago so I'm happy to stick with the odds
Finals
MaNavs Polt- the Korean is a slight favourite (59%), despite Polt having an excellent TvP record and MaNa struggling against Korean Terrans, so I'll stick with Captain America here (if this goes via Aligulac then Polt faces FireCake again and wins)

Both Aligulac and I (and Team Liquid) see the Koreans going through, albeit we come at it in a different way.

Group D
An all-foreign group featuring all the races.  Welmu arrives with a clean sweep over HuK and iaguz; Kane is here via his Cuban vacation after beating Happy and TargA; Bunny overcame an ill viOLet along with MajOr; Has is here after beating NaNiwa in a re-match (along with knocking off Suppy).

Welmu vs Bunny - the Dane is favoured (63%), which seems low given his 20-2 record against Protoss this year, so it's easy to stick with the favourite
Has vs Kane - the Canadian is a slight favourite (55%), but given the fact he's just back from vacation with no time to prepare (he's also said publically he'll lose out here), I'll give this to the cheesy Protoss
Losers Match
Welmu vs Kane - Kane is again a very slight favourite (50%), but the Canadian's impressive ZvP record is largely built off the back of weaker NA competition so I'll go with Welmu here; if this is the Finn vs Has Aligulac has Welmu winning
Winners Match
Bunny vs Has- the Dane is an overwhelming favourite (74%), despite both players being excellent in the match-up (Has restricted to his limited scene); I don't see an upset here though, as Has-cheese seems much more effective against Protoss
Finals
Welmu vs Has - the link to the numbers are above (60%), with Welmu having far more impressive results

Both Aligulac and I (and TL) see Bunny and Welmu moving forward.
